Technology Transformation Drives Innovation

Many organizations are adopting cutting-edge technologies, such as cloud computing, artificial intelligence (AI) and data analytics, to drive innovation and remain competitive. This technological overhaul is reshaping how businesses operate, redefining industry standards and creating new opportunities for growth and differentiation. According to a survey of 750 C-level executives by Broadridge, 73 percent of organizations that are leaders in digital transformation saw increased revenue, and a majority saw increased profitability.

10 Technology Transformation Strategies

Implementing technology transformation strategies can not only drive revenues and profitability but also innovation. Here are several strategies that organizations can leverage to achieve these benefits:

  • Cloud adoption: Deploy secure cloud infrastructure to enhance your organization’s IT infrastructure’s scalability, flexibility and accessibility. With cloud solutions, new technologies and applications can be deployed more quickly, allowing for rapid innovation and experimentation.
  • Automation: Identify areas within the organization where technology can automate manual processes. This way, operations can be streamlined, errors can be reduced and employees can focus more on creative tasks.
  • Data analytics: Invest in data analytics tools and platforms to gain insights from your organization’s data that can be analyzed to find trends, identify optimization opportunities and inform strategic decisions.
  • Emerging technologies: Leverage emerging technologies such as artificial intelligence, machine learning, blockchain and the Internet of Things (IoT). Identify ways to apply these technologies to your organization’s products, services and processes to improve efficiency and profitability.
  • Collaboration tools: Use collaboration tools and platforms to improve communication and knowledge sharing among employees. Collaboration and idea exchange across functional lines foster a culture of innovation.
  •  Agile development: Implement agile methodologies such as Scrum or Kanban in your software development processes. This enables quick adaptations to fast-moving requirements and getting products and features to market faster.
  • Continuous learning: Provide employees with opportunities to learn new skills, especially in areas related to technology and innovation. Offer training programs, workshops and opportunities for hands-on experimentation with new technologies.
  • Open innovation: Establish partnerships with external organizations, such as startups, research institutions and industry associations, to leverage their expertise and get access to cutting-edge technologies. Innovation efforts can be accelerated by collaborating with external stakeholders.
  • Customer-centric design: Utilize technology to gather customer feedback, analyze behavior and tailor offerings to meet customers’ evolving needs and preferences.
  • Leadership support: Ensure that senior leadership fully supports technology transformation initiatives. Provide clear goals, adequate resources and strategic direction to establish a technology-enabled culture of innovation.

Technology transformation involves both technical and cultural challenges. Using the latest technologies can increase efficiency and reduce costs for your business, but only if your team has the necessary structure and skills.
